William Blair & Company's BIPC Position: Q2 2026 in Review

William Blair & Company reduced its Brookfield Infrastructure (BIPC) stake by 0.44% in Q2 2026, selling an estimated $1.29K and leaving 7,200 shares worth $277K. The position accounts for ﹤0.01% of the portfolio, ranked #1454.

William Blair & Company first reported a position in BIPC in Q1 2021 and has held it in 7 quarters since. The position peaked at $286K in Q1 2026. 393 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old BIPC as of Q2 2026.
